Nawazuddin Siddiqui to star in Honey Trehan’s directorial debut

Fresh off his ninth appearance at the Cannes Film Festival, where his Nandita Das-directed ‘Manto’ biopic was screened in the ‘Un Certain Regard’ category, Nawazuddin Siddiqui dived into the shooting of another biographical drama, based on the late Cannes Film Festival
 
Reports now also say that the 44-year-old actor has green-lit another film, which will be spearheaded by filmmaker Honey Trehan, who has previously assisted Vishal Bhardwaj on ‘Kaminey’ (2009) and ‘7 Khoon Maaf’ (2011), reports the Ahmedabad Mirror
 
“Honey has been working on the script for a while now. It is a crime-thriller and is set in the interiors of India. Nawaz has really liked the script and has given his nod to the film but is yet to sign on the dotted line. Meanwhile, Honey has begun work on the preproduction and is on the lookout for his leading lady. They are expected to start work early next year and Nawaz will begin his prep closer to the shooting date,” informs a source close to the development.
 
Trehan was earlier gearing up to make his directorial debut with the Deepika Padukone and Irrfan Khan-starrer project that takes off from the story ‘Femme Fatale’ from Hussain Zaidi’s book, ‘Mafia Queens of Mumbai,’ and was to be produced by Vishal. However, the duo had subsequently agreed that the latter should take over the directorial reins.
 
“Owing to differences in creative understanding, we have mutually and amicably decided that it would be best for our film if Vishal sir took over as director,” Trehan had earlier said in a statement.
 
Meanwhile Siddiqui, who was last seen in Kushan Nandy’s crime drama, ‘Babumoshai Bandookbaaz’ (2017), has recently completed the dubbing for Ritesh Batra’s ‘Photograph.’
